Seven dead after overpass under construction collapses in SW China
SEVEN people were killed Sunday after an overpass under construction collapsed in southwest China's Yunnan Province, local officials said.
The accident also left eight people seriously injured and 26 others with light injures. It happened at 2:20 p.m., when an overpass under construction collapsed in an uncompleted airport in Kunming, the provincial capital, said a spokesman with the municipal government.
Among the 41 workers at the site, six workers were killed at the scene, while another one was found dead after his body was retrieved in the debris, the spokesman said.
The collapsed section was 38 meters long and 13 meters wide, he said.
With an investment of 23 billion yuan (3.37 billion U.S. dollars), the airport is designed to put through 38 million passengers every year, he said.
The cause of the accident is under investigation.
